Technical Whitepaper

Industrial Cooling & Evaporative Concentration Systems Integration

Modern process design increasingly demands the integration of industrial chillers and heavy duty evaporative systems. In large-scale chemical processing, food fermentation, and pharmaceutical synthesis, thermodynamic balance is key.

An industrial chiller factory does not operate in isolation; it must design systems that align with concentration plants. Vaporization in falling film evaporators or mechanical vapor recompression (MVR) loops creates cooling loads and thermal recovery points. Integrating a premium industrial chiller cycle directly with waste-heat loop condensation pathways ensures maximum thermodynamic efficiency and zero energy waste.

This combined systems approach ensures that heat rejected from cooling loops is routed back into multi-effect evaporators or pre-heating stations. The results include a minimized thermal footprint, optimized coefficient of performance (COP) ratings, and a simplified water conservation framework across the site.

Core Mechanical Synergies

  • Precise Coolant Loops: Steady low-temperature liquid feeds protect thermal-sensitive chemical structures.
  • Dynamic COP Balance: Adapting chiller loops to match evaporator concentration variations.
  • Scale Mitigation: Constant thermal regulation prevents crystallization on heat exchange surfaces.
  • ASME U-Stamp Security: Every unit is designed to handle high pressures and corrosive fluids safely.

Core Product Categories & Design Criteria

Understanding the fluid mechanics and drying kinematics of our key machinery.

Evaporators

From single-effect to MVR systems, including falling film and forced circulation. Engineered to balance boiling rates, film thickness, and vapor velocities, ensuring continuous processing without fouling.

Single Screw Presses

Highly efficient solid-liquid mechanical separation equipment. Designed to apply progressive volumetric compression, extracting bulk moisture prior to entering energy-intensive thermal drying units.

Tube Bundle Dryers

Indirect steam heating systems designed for continuous bulk solids processing. These dryers keep the material in contact with heated rotating tubes, preventing product oxidation under mild temperatures.

Airflow Dryers

Features high-speed pneumatic suspension drying systems. Perfect for quick surface moisture removal, these systems process starches and organic fibers in seconds using dynamic hot air loops.

Degerming Mills

Designed for grain processing, ensuring precision corn germ release without damaging starch-bearing kernels. These mills utilize adjustable clearances to maintain long-term industrial mechanical reliability.

Starch Washing Cyclones

Multi-stage centrifugal separation systems engineered to wash, concentrate, and refine starch slurries. These cyclones maximize yield while minimizing clean water consumption across the system.

Product Spotlight: Airflow Dryer

Jiangsu Zongheng's MQG Airflow Dryer

The MQG Airflow Dryer is designed to process wet particulate substances at high speeds. Suspended in a hot air stream, moisture evaporates instantly as particles travel through a system of expanding and contracting ducts.

The system alters the velocity boundary layer around the particles, keeping them in suspension without allowing them to settle. This protects heat-sensitive compounds while delivering a consistent dry discharge.

Product Spotlight: Evaporator

Falling Film Evaporation Plant

Our Falling Film Evaporators are designed for concentration lines requiring minimal thermal degradation. By feeding liquid to the top of vertical tubes, it flows downward as a thin film, which speeds up evaporation.

Our liquid distribution designs prevent dry spots, which helps reduce scale buildup on the heat transfer tubes. Operating under vacuum, these systems run at lower boiling temperatures, reducing overall energy use.

Manufacturer Profile

Jiangsu Zongheng Concentrating and Drying Equipment Co., Ltd

Established in 1992 (originally Yixing Yangxi Light Industry Machinery Factory), Jiangsu Zongheng is located in Zhoutie Town, Yixing City, near Taihu Lake. Our modern, high-tech facility covers over 54,000 square meters, featuring a 22,000 square meter fabrication shop.

As an active member of the China Starch and Alcohol Association, we specialize in concentration systems, industrial dryers, starch refining lines, alcohol DDGS processes, and Category III medium-to-low pressure vessels.

We maintain ISO9001 and ASME "U" stamp certifications, ensuring all pressure vessels meet global safety and quality standards. Our systems are used worldwide in food fermentation, chemical processing, pharmaceuticals, and environmental engineering.

Technical FAQ

Frequently Asked Questions

Addressing common questions regarding design, thermodynamics, and system integration.

Q1: How does the integration of industrial chillers and MVR evaporators reduce power consumption?
Integrating these systems allows you to route high-temperature discharge vapor from the concentration loop through a heat exchanger cooled by the process chiller. This minimizes overall energy consumption by capturing heat that would otherwise be lost.
Q2: What benefits does the ASME U-Stamp provide for international projects?
The ASME U-stamp certifies that pressure vessels meet international safety code requirements. This streamlines global compliance and site-safety approvals for large-scale projects.
Q3: Why use a falling film design instead of standard forced circulation for heat-sensitive liquids?
Falling film evaporators offer shorter residence times and require smaller temperature differences. This prevents thermal degradation of sensitive compounds, such as food proteins, starch slurries, and organic pharmaceutical mixtures.
Q4: How do single screw presses improve the performance of downstream tube bundle dryers?
By mechanically extracting bulk water beforehand, single screw presses significantly reduce the thermal load on tube bundle dryers, decreasing overall steam consumption in the drying loop.
Q5: What materials of construction are typically used for high-fouling process applications?
Depending on chemical compatibility and acidity, we construct our systems using titanium, duplex stainless steels (such as 2205), or grades 316L/304, protecting heat exchange surfaces from corrosive and abrasive wear.
